Halifax Firefighters Battle Major Apartment Blaze, Emergency Response Mobilized
Firefighters in Halifax, Nova Scotia, were engaged in a significant operation on April 5, 2026, as they battled a serious apartment fire. The incident, which drew a substantial emergency response, saw crews working diligently to contain the flames and safeguard residents and property.
Emergency Crews Respond to Intense Blaze
According to reports, the fire broke out in an apartment building, prompting a swift mobilization of Halifax Fire and Emergency services. Multiple units were dispatched to the scene, with firefighters employing hoses and specialized equipment to combat the blaze. The intensity of the fire required a coordinated effort to prevent its spread to adjacent structures.
The cause of the fire remains under investigation, with authorities examining potential factors such as electrical faults or accidental ignition. No immediate fatalities have been reported, but injuries and displacements are being assessed as emergency personnel conduct thorough checks of the building.
